How to Straighten Facts About the Lawsuit
Understanding your potential role requires clarity, not fear. The current legal posture largely involves individual complaints centered on:
- Charging errors on monthly statements
- Automatic renewals or subscription traps
- Disputes over service fees or account closures
No mass liability or class-wide penalties are confirmed. The 4## Shocking Bank of America Lawsuit Details: Are You an Unknowing Victim? likely references real but isolated cases—not a sweeping verdict.
The process typically begins when a customer files a complaint with the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au (CFPB) or state banking agencies. After review, escalation may trigger legal action if systemic issues are found. But for most users, the path involves consultation—not immediate claims.

Common Questions About the Bank of America Lawsuit
H3: Am I automatically part of a lawsuit?
No. Being affected requires documented discrepancies on your account. Reporting concerns through official channels is the safest step.
